How to Manage Your Online Reputation
Track Your Online Reputation Regularly
The first step in reputation management is staying on top of what people are saying about your business. Regularly check review sites like Google, Yelp, or Trustpilot, and monitor social media mentions. Tools like Google Alerts can help you stay updated on new content or mentions of your business.

Ask Customers for Positive Feedback
Positive reviews are a powerful way to enhance your business’s reputation. Encourage happy customers to leave feedback on platforms like Google My Business (GMB). After a successful transaction, send a polite reminder to ask customers to leave a review. Reply to Customer Feedback
Don’t ignore customer reviews! Responding to both positive and negative reviews shows that you care about their opinions. If you get a negative review, respond promptly and offer solutions. This can turn a dissatisfied customer into a loyal one. If you get a glowing review, thank the customer and show appreciation. This keeps your reputation strong and shows good customer service.

Use Social Media to Your Advantage
Social media is an excellent platform for engaging with your audience and shaping your reputation. Be active on platforms like Facebook, Twitter, and Instagram, where you can engage with customers, answer questions, and promote your services. A strong social media presence can positively influence how people perceive your business.

Provide Exceptional Customer Service

Dealing with Negative Reviews
No matter how well you manage your reputation, you will eventually encounter negative feedback. How you handle it is crucial. When a customer leaves a bad review, stay calm and polite. Acknowledge the issue, apologize if necessary, and offer a solution. A prompt and thoughtful response can often turn a negative experience into a positive one.
